If the Lumenfare ticket-pricing experiment keeps flipping users between variants, check the bucketing seed first — it should come from the visitor cookie, not the request IP. A recent refactor in `priceSplit.ts` swapped those, so anyone behind a shared gateway gets rebucketed constantly. Quick sanity check: hit the experiment debug endpoint twice and confirm the variant matches. That endpoint sits behind the experiments gateway, so include the bearer token shown below in your request header.

portal login ticket: eyJhbGciOiJIUzI1NiIsInR5cCI6IkpXVCJ9.eyJzdWIiOiIMjvRAf3PEFIn0.nuv9gjixLtnr

The garage occupancy feed for the Brindlewood campus arrives over a message queue every thirty seconds, one record per level, published by the Stallgrid edge boxes. Counts can briefly go negative when a sensor double-fires on exit; the ingest job clamps these to zero and flags the interval. If the feed stalls for more than five minutes, the dashboard falls back to the last known snapshot. Sensor mappings, queue names, and the replay procedure are documented on the internal page below.

runbook for tahog-kadug: https://gitlab.qirvanworks.corp/projects/pages/view/b139298aed28

CI note for the weekly sync: the Larkspur firmware update channel failed promotion twice this week. Root cause appears to be the staging signer at Quellhaven rotating its attestation cert mid-pipeline, so devices on the beta ring rejected the manifest as untrusted. We re-ran the promotion after pinning the signer snapshot, and the Bramblewick test rack accepted the payload cleanly. Please do not retrigger promotions manually until the rotation window closes Thursday. For verification, compare your local manifest against the token below.

pipeline stamp: htk31_f769b577b3028a4e9958e5bb8d1259a